EMPORIO ARMANI CLASSIC723763216043
The EMPORIO ARMANI CLASSIC723763216043 is equipped with a precise quartz movement that ensures reliable timekeeping. This movement guarantees exact accuracy and requires minimal maintenance, making the watch an ideal everyday companion.
The case has a diameter of 40 mm and is made of high-quality stainless steel, known not only for its durability but also for its elegant appearance. The combination of robust material and timeless design makes this watch a stylish accessory for any occasion.
The stainless steel bracelet perfectly complements the case and ensures a comfortable fit on the wrist. With a water resistance of up to 5 ATM, the watch is also splash-proof and ideal for everyday use. Its functions are limited to displaying the time, making it simple and intuitive to use.
